A2)
Heating valve and/or actuator
does not work
RTC/STC/HTC
Check the actuator and valve
function
Check the actuator by pulling out
the electrical cable and refit it
again; this will start an automatic
self-test for the actuator. Check
the flow using the energy meter
while test-running the valve.
If no energy meter is available,
disconnect the heating actuator
from the valve. Carefully depress
the valve’s spindle with a tool and
check the valve’s travel and spring
back.
Note: The valve may be very hot

A3)
Heating supply temperature
sensor and outdoor temperature
sensor (option) does not work
Check the heating supply temperature sensor and outdoor
temperature sensor (option)
Check that they are correctly cited and working. To confirm that sensors
are connected and operating, press the info button on the room
thermostat, check that the specified temperatures are reasonable.
B. No heating
Reason
Action
B1)
Circulation pump not running
Check that the electrical power is on
Check the circulation pump
If the pump fails to start after stopping, try to start it at the highest setting.
Check the heating parameters in room thermostat
Summer reduction (Economy function) parameter 2, category 2: If
measured outdoor temperature is higher than target temperature, the
pump should not be operating.
Pump difference (Economy function) parameter 3, category 2:
If the calculated water supply temperature is not greater than the outside
temperature by this amount the heating will switch off.
If parameter 3 is set to 0, the pump operation will not be affected by this
parameter.

B3)
Loss of function in the heating
control unit.
Run the pump manually
If it becomes necessary to run the pump and actuator manually, this can
be done by disconnecting the power to the room thermostat.
Disconnect the electrical plug for the pump. Connect the replacement
cable (option) to the power supply and to the circulation pump. Next,
open the heating valve manually using the knob on the actuator. Open
the control valve sufficiently to satisfy the heating needs.
